5. Phase Execution
Command: /gsd-execute-phase <N>
Purpose: Execute all plans in a phase using wave-based parallelization with fresh context windows per executor.
Requirements:
- REQ-EXEC-01: System MUST analyze plan dependencies and group into execution waves
- REQ-EXEC-02: System MUST spawn independent plans in parallel within each wave
- REQ-EXEC-03: System MUST give each executor a fresh context window (200K tokens)
- REQ-EXEC-04: System MUST produce atomic git commits per task
- REQ-EXEC-05: System MUST produce a SUMMARY.md for each completed plan
- REQ-EXEC-06: System MUST run post-execution verifier to check phase goals were met
- REQ-EXEC-07: System MUST support git branching strategies (
none,phase,milestone) - REQ-EXEC-08: System MUST invoke node repair operator on task verification failure (when enabled)
- REQ-EXEC-09: System MUST run prior phases' test suites before verification to catch cross-phase regressions
Produces:
| Artifact | Description |
|---|---|
{phase}-{N}-SUMMARY.md |
Execution outcomes per plan |
{phase}-VERIFICATION.md |
Post-execution verification report |
| Git commits | Atomic commits per task |
Wave Execution:
- Plans with no dependencies → Wave 1 (parallel)
- Plans depending on Wave 1 → Wave 2 (parallel, waits for Wave 1)
- Continues until all plans complete
- File conflicts force sequential execution within same wave
Executor Capabilities:
- Reads PLAN.md with full task instructions
- Has access to PROJECT.md, STATE.md, CONTEXT.md, RESEARCH.md
- Commits each task atomically with structured commit messages
- Uses
--no-verifyon commits during parallel execution to avoid build lock contention - Handles checkpoint types:
auto,checkpoint:human-verify,checkpoint:decision,checkpoint:human-action - Reports deviations from plan in SUMMARY.md
Parallel Safety:
- Pre-commit hooks: Skipped by parallel agents (
--no-verify), run once by orchestrator after each wave - STATE.md locking: File-level lockfile prevents concurrent write corruption across agents

108. Plan Bounce
Command: /gsd-plan-phase N --bounce
Purpose: After plans pass the checker, optionally refine them through an external script (a second AI, a linter, a custom validator). The bounce step backs up each plan, runs the script, validates YAML frontmatter integrity on the result, re-runs the plan checker, and restores the original if anything fails.
Requirements:
- REQ-BOUNCE-01:
--bounceflag orworkflow.plan_bounce: trueactivates the step;--skip-bouncealways disables it - REQ-BOUNCE-02:
workflow.plan_bounce_scriptmust point to a valid executable; missing script produces a warning and skips - REQ-BOUNCE-03: Each plan is backed up to
*-PLAN.pre-bounce.mdbefore the script runs - REQ-BOUNCE-04: Bounced plans with broken YAML frontmatter or that fail the plan checker are restored from backup
- REQ-BOUNCE-05:
workflow.plan_bounce_passes(default: 2) controls how many refinement passes the script receives
Configuration: workflow.plan_bounce, workflow.plan_bounce_script, workflow.plan_bounce_passes

116. TDD Pipeline Mode
Purpose: Opt-in TDD (red-green-refactor) as a first-class phase execution mode. When enabled, the planner aggressively selects type: tdd for eligible tasks and the executor enforces RED/GREEN/REFACTOR gate sequence with fail-fast on unexpected GREEN before RED.
Requirements:
- REQ-TDD-01:
workflow.tdd_modeconfig key (boolean, defaultfalse) - REQ-TDD-02: When enabled, planner applies TDD heuristics from
references/tdd.mdto all eligible tasks (business logic, APIs, validations, algorithms, state machines) - REQ-TDD-03: Executor enforces gate sequence for
type: tddplans — RED commit (test(...)) must precede GREEN commit (feat(...)) - REQ-TDD-04: Executor fails fast if tests pass unexpectedly during RED phase (feature already exists or test is wrong)
- REQ-TDD-05: End-of-phase collaborative review checkpoint verifies gate compliance across all TDD plans (advisory, non-blocking)
- REQ-TDD-06: Gate violations surfaced in SUMMARY.md under
## TDD Gate Compliancesection
Configuration: workflow.tdd_mode
Reference files: tdd.md, checkpoints.md
